My Camera


My camera!
I LOVE it!!!
It's a Canon Rebel T3.
Worth every penny to me!

And.... because of my craziness in pinching pennies... I got it on sale!
But from the Canon website. It was a refurbished one, but came with a 1 year warrenty.

So I saved $200, and still got it from the company it was made, packaged like new and with the warranty.

Sometimes, you can pinch pennies and find a great deal so that you can still have that item you want so badly!!!

Mine has been going for 2 years strong now... Love love it!!

Wednesday, October 28, 2015

When I first started staying home, it was over-whelming! I felt like I spent 99% of my time picking up and it didn't matter. 
And to think, I only had 2 kiddos then!

I will never forget talking to my mom about it one day, and she suggested that I pick a room. Pick 1 room that I want to keep clean. This may sound crazy - didn't I want the whole house clean? Well of course, BUT, if I could feel ok with the house if at least my kitchen was clean - then that helped!
Of course I keep up with the rest of the house, but at least I don't feel like I am loosing all control if at least my kitchen is clean!


Our old house the kitchen was not a room we walked through to come in the house - our new house we do. The kids and I come in through the garage in the kitchen door, so sometimes it's where everything is dropped.

But, I still try to keep my kitchen picked up and clean! 
Everything has it's place, I don't sit down for the night unless if the dishes are done and the kitchen is swept.
Somehow... this makes the toys in the living room a bit more bareable ;)


And I found this adorable tin dish that I keep my kitchen scrubbies in for $5! 
And I love to keep lemon fresh hand soap in my kitchen.

Just a few things that I enjoy... in a room I spend so much of my day in.
